Embodiment approach 2
[0104] Figure 8 It is a functional block diagram showing the configuration of the risk information collection device 200 according to Embodiment 2 of the present invention. Figure 8 The shown hazard information collection device 200 has figure 1 In addition to the configuration of the danger information collection device 100 according to Embodiment 1 shown, a danger association information database 105 is provided. In addition, in Figure 8 in, about and use figure 1 The same configurations of the danger information collection device 100 described above are denoted by the same reference numerals, and redundant descriptions are omitted.
[0105] The danger association information database 105 stores information that associates danger for each passenger information. That is, when the passenger information is words uttered by the passenger, words associated with danger are stored. Examples of words associated with danger include "didn't see", "very dangerous", and "barely"...
